Overview

The YD-Link 10 is the datalink behind every long-range YivaDrone flight: a 900 MHz spread-spectrum module that tunnels MAVLink transparently between the flight controller and your ground station, with dual-antenna diversity for multipath-heavy environments.

The air module weighs 22 g and takes 5 V from the flight controller rail; the ground module runs off USB. Pairing is automatic — power both units and telemetry appears in QGroundControl.
